Smoking - The Facts
Two-thirds of all smokers want to give up but can't.
One half of all smokers will die prematurely because of their habit.
The smell from smoking will linger on your clothes and in your house for days.
About 120,000 people die each year in the UK from smoking related illnesses - which is 330 deaths a day.
At current prices, a person smoking 20 cigarettes a day could spend up to £100,000 during their lifetime on cigarettes.
More people die from smoking than from breast cancer, AIDS, traffic accidents and drug addiction added together.
More than 17,000 children under the age of five are admitted to hospital every year because of the effects of passive smoking.
